    FG reverses suspension of REA MD Ogunbiyi

    The Federal Government has reversed the suspension of Managing Director of Rural Electricity Agency (REA) Mrs Damilola Ogunbiyi.

    Ogunbiyi was suspended over alleged malpractices on December 31.

    The FG, however, accepted her resignation to enable her take up her new role in the United Nations (UN).

    President Muhammadu Buhari had on 31 December approved the appointment of Mr Ahmad Salihijo Ahmad as the Managing Director and Chief Executive Officer of the Rural Electrification Agency.

    Ahmad replaces Damilola Ogunbiyi who has overseen some of the milestone achievements in the agency.

    Mr Aaron Artimas, the Special Adviser, Media and Communication to the Minister of Power, made this known in a statement in Abuja on Tuesday.

    Artimas said that Ahmad, a renewable energy expert, holds two masters degree in development studies and project planning.
